Credentials And Qualifications
Certifications and qualifications function as important indicators of a competent auto mechanic's capability. Mechanics who have certifications from reputable organizations, such as the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E), reflect a commitment to industry criteria and continuous education. These credentials often indicate expertise in different automotive systems, assuring the mechanic can skillfully identify and fix issues. Additionally, manufacturers may provide specific training programs, leading to certifications that validate a mechanic's ability with certain makes and models. When seeking reliable auto services, assessing a mechanic’s certifications can give assurance of their skills and knowledge. This focus on qualifications helps customers make smart choices, ultimately contributing to safer and more effective vehicle care.

Frequent Vehicle Troubles Optimally Managed by Professionals
Many car owners experience problems that require the expertise of a skilled technician. Problems such as persistent engine misfires, unusual noises, or warning lights can suggest more serious mechanical problems that require specialized knowledge and tools. Transmission issues, including gear slipping or fluid leaks, often require expert diagnosis to prevent expensive repairs. Electrical problems, like discharged batteries or faulty wiring, are complex and can lead to content additional issues if not handled properly.
Furthermore, braking mechanism malfunctions, whether they involve worn pads or hydraulic issues, demand immediate professional intervention to guarantee safety. Suspension problems, such as irregular tire deterioration or excessive bouncing, can impact vehicle handling and comfort, requiring expert assessment. While some minor repairs can be managed by vehicle owners, these common problems are best handled by trained professionals to guarantee reliability and safety on the road.

Initial Vehicle Appraisal Protocol
Upon walking into an auto repair shop, it commences the vehicle assessment process, where a experienced mechanic meticulously evaluates the car's condition. This assessment starts with a visual inspection, focusing on exterior damage, tire wear, and fluid leaks. The mechanic then conducts a diagnostic check using specialized tools to pinpoint potential electronic or mechanical issues. Customers may be asked about any unusual sounds or performance problems encountered while driving, providing valuable context for the evaluation. Following this thorough examination, the mechanic compiles findings and may suggest further diagnostic tests if necessary. This initial assessment ensures that the vehicle receives appropriate care, tackling both immediate concerns and underlying issues that may affect performance and safety.

How Regularly Should I Have My Vehicle Serviced?
Vehicles ought to be serviced every 5,000 to 7,500 miles or every six months, whichever comes first. Routine inspections help guarantee optimal performance, boost safety, and prolong the vehicle's lifespan for improved durability on the road.
What should I manage if My Vehicle Stops Working?
If a vehicle malfunctions, the driver should carefully move to the side of the road, activate hazard lights, and assess the situation. If needed, reaching out to roadside assistance or a tow service is recommended to ensure safety and proper handling.
